My husband and I adopted a daughter 5.5 years ago through Living Legacy Adoption Agency in Dallas. It took about 6 months to get chosen by a birthmom after our application and profiles were complete. Our adoption is semi-open but at this agency you and the birthmom can agree upon how open or closed you both want it. The agency doesn't dictate that. We have contact with the birthmother and she visited us and the baby for the first 2 years but we no longer have visitation until the child is older. It works for us.

The key is to find an agency that provides counseling to the birthmothers because it is a really hard decision to make and it heart breaking to hand the baby over to someone else to be the baby's parent. Without counseling and a really good support system, many girls don't have the strength to go through with it. Living Legacy was really good with the counseling. Not just about giving the child up for adoption but if they were wanting to parent they provided life skills counseling including how to budget, get a job, cook and clean, basic stuff that many young girls in that situation don't know how to do.
